Description
2-Butoxyethyl 4-Aminobenzoate is a benzoate ester derivative of 4-aminobenzoic acid, valued for its solubility and functional properties. This compound serves as a versatile intermediate and active ingredient in specialized industrial and pharmaceutical formulations. It is primarily sought by manufacturers in the personal care, pharmaceutical, and specialty chemical sectors for its unique chemical profile.

Basic Information
| Product Name | 2-Butoxyethyl 4-Aminobenzoate |
| CAS No. | 49610-67-5 |
| Molecular Formula | C13H19NO3 |
| Molecular Weight | 237.29 g/mol |
| Synonyms | 4-Aminobenzoic Acid 2-Butoxyethyl Ester; Benzoic acid, 4-amino-, 2-butoxyethyl ester; Ethanol, 2-butoxy-, 4-aminobenzoate; 2-Butoxyethyl p-aminobenzoate; Butoxyethyl Aminobenzoate |
| EINECS | 256-400-5 |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at controlled room temperature (typically 15-25°C). Keep away from incompatible materials such as strong oxidizing agents.
